SUMMARY:Youth Sports & Mental Health
DESCRIPTION:Participating in team sports can help children become more confident\, social\, inquisitive\, respectful and engaged. However\, pressure from adults can cause a positive activity to become a negative stressor. \nJoin us with Kathryn Ames\, a licensed professional counselor and founder of Thru the Game\, and USA Olympian Ben Pinelman as they share strategies on how to prioritize youth’s mental health while participating in sports. \nClick here to register via Zoom.

SUMMARY:Milestones Matter Part 4: Kindergarten Readiness: Is My Child Ready for Kindergarten?
DESCRIPTION:Transitioning from preschool to kindergarten can be both challenging and exciting and there is much to consider to ensure your child is prepared to thrive: \n• Is my child able to identify and regulate emotions?\n• Does my child have age appropriate self-help skills?\n• Can my child understand and follow two-step directions? \nJoin us to learn more about your child’s development and ways to support a positive\, successful transition to kindergarten. \nPresented by Michelle Mertic\, MSW\, LMSW\, EdD\, Director of Early Childhood Education\, Baker College \nTo register for this Zoom meeting click here. \nFor questions:\nTGC Early Head Start/Head Start parents contact Kristie Shields at 734-785-7705 x7541.\nAll other parents contact Jane Reitman at 734-785-7705 x7369.

SUMMARY:Milestones Matter Part 1: The Early Years (Birth up to 36 months)
DESCRIPTION:Developmental milestones are the skills most children achieve by a certain age such as rolling over\, crawling\, walking or talking.
